Removes the YouTube Shorts feed. Getting back in costs you fifteen seconds of holding a button.

Vertical Hold removes the YouTube Shorts feed from YouTube. Shorts reach you three different ways, so Vertical Hold blocks three different ways: • Pasted or bookmarked Shorts links are redirected before anything loads. • Shorts clicked from inside YouTube are caught too — those never make a network request, so a second layer watches for them. • Shorts you would otherwise see in passing are removed from the page entirely: the homepage shelf, the Subscriptions shelf, the shelf wedged into search results, the channel Shorts tab, the sidebar link, "Shorts remixing this video", and the mobile web equivalents. A Short someone sends you is still watchable. The blocked page offers to play it as an ordinary video in the ordinary player — one video, then it ends, with nothing to swipe to. GETTING BACK IN Hold a button for fifteen seconds and Shorts unlock for five minutes, after which the block silently re-arms. Releasing early resets the timer to zero; it does not accumulate. Both durations are configurable, and you can choose which surfaces get cleaned up. There is deliberately no unlock button in the toolbar popup. The cost belongs at the moment of the decision. This is friction, not a wall. Anything you install, you can uninstall — the point is to make the easy path the one you actually wanted. PRIVACY Vertical Hold collects nothing, sends nothing, and makes no network requests. It has no servers, no analytics, and no third-party code. Your settings and the unlock timer are stored by Chrome on your own device and nowhere else. The name is the knob on an old television that stopped the picture from rolling endlessly. That is roughly the job.
